

Born on September 19, 1932, in Pensacola, Florida, at 4:22 PM, John led a life marked by service, quiet strength, and unwavering love for his family. He proudly served his country for 22 years in the United States Air Force and later continued his dedication to public service through volunteering for MOAA at MacDill AFB and Operation Helping Hands in Tampa.
On April 6, 1968, John married the love of his life, Ann. Together, they built a strong and loving family rooted in faith and resilience. John served as a deacon in his church and was a pillar of his community, admired for his steady presence and calm leadership in times of both joy and sorrow.
John was a passionate man who found joy in simple pleasures: golf, model airplanes, great food, traveling the world, church fellowship, college football, and most of all, time with his family. A lifelong aviation enthusiast, he was known for his fascination with flight and the skies above.
